Response of Sunflower (Helianthus annuus L.) to Fractionation of Humic Acids and Spraying with Azolla Extract.

Abstrakt: A field experiment was concluded in the 2022 spring season.in field of Al-Khader district, 30 km south of Al-Muthanna Governorate, to evaluate the impact of the productivity of sunflower to fractionation (30 kg Ha-1 ) of humic acids at three levels (one batch, two batches, three batches) and spraying with an extract Azolla at four concentrations (0, 20%, 40% and 60%), A randomized complete block design was used for the experiment with three replications and by split-plot method by placing humic acid fractionation levels in a main plots, spraying Azolla concentrations in the secondary plots. The study found that level of fragmentation was superior in two batches in 1000 seeds weight, the individual yield of the plant and the total seed yield with averages of (84.85 gm and 98.31 gm plant-1 and 5.24 tons ha1 ) for the traits in sequence, while the level of fragmentation was superior by three batches in the diameter of the disc and the number of seeds Filled with two averages of (22.75 cm and 961.25 seeds disc-1 ) for the two traits, respectively, spraying Azolla extract at a concentration of 40% was significantly better and generated the greatest mean of disc diameter, number of filled seeds, 1000 seeds weight, individual plant yield and total seed yield, which amounted to 22.60 cm and 1027.86 seed disc-1, 85.81 gm, 102.75 gm plant-1 and 5.47 tons ha-1 ) for the traits respectively. The interaction between the two research variables was significant because the two together (40% Azolla extract with splitting in three batches) achieved the highest two averages The weight of 1,000 seeds and the total number of seeds reached (1089.30 seeds disc1 and 90.27 g) for the two traits, respectively.
